N.Z. FINANCES

PUBLIC ACCOUNTS GAZETTED. (By Telegraph —Press Association). WELLINGTON, June 13. The public accounts for the year were gazetted to-day, hut the usual summary was not furnished by the 'Treasury, as it explains the ground has already been covered by the Prime Minister in his public address. it may, however, he stated that the ordinary revenue for the year is shown as £22,864,723. Amongst other receipts were: Territorial £198,802, T)eoartmontal receipts by Justice, Printing and other ...departments £625,063. credits in reduction £1,183,016, Tin expenditure includes: Interest £11,339,568; under special acts £0. l> 3.196; annual appropriations £9.094,218. The Public Works Account shows a balance in hand, of £3,889,083.
